(1) Institute of Metal Physics, Russian Academy of Sciences Ural Division, 620219 Yekatarinburg GSP-170, Russia Received: 31 October 1997 / Received in final form: 28 November 1997 / Accepted: 18 December 1997 Abstract: The XPS MnL-spectra of Co2MnSn, a nearly half-metallic ferromagnet (HMF) and Pd2MnSn were investigated. The most drastical feature of the spectra observed is the well-defined magnetic splitting of the Mn 2p3/2, 2p1/2 lines. This gives direct evidence of the existence of well-defined local magnetic moments in Heusler alloys in comparison with other itinerant-electron ferromagnets. The calculations of Mn2p XPS spectra of these materials were carried out using a fully relativistic generalization of the one-step model of photoemission and show excellent agreement with experiment.
